0 Replies Latest reply on Mar 26, 2013 9:36 AM by bha007

    Can't build JBoss AS 5.1.0 (any more?)

    bha007

      Hi,

       

      I have to do a little maintenance stuff on old JBoss 5.1.GA

      So I did a fresh checkout

       

      $ svn co http://anonsvn.jboss.org/repos/jbossas/tags/JBoss_5_1_0_GA/

      $ cd JBoss_5_1_0_GA/build

      $ ./build.sh

       

      I'm not a mvn Guru but build does not start, here's what it gronks :

       

      Searching for build.xml ...

      Buildfile: /data/jboss_builds/src/svn/JBoss_5_1_0_GA/build/build.xml

       

      maven-init:

           [echo] Maven Home set to /data/jboss_builds/src/svn/JBoss_5_1_0_GA/tools/maven

       

      maven-install:

           [java] [INFO] Scanning for projects...

           [java] [INFO] Reactor build order:

           [java] [INFO]   JBossAS Component Matrix

           [java] [INFO]   JBoss Application Server Parent POM

           [java] [INFO]   JBoss Application Server Thirdparty Build

           [java] WAGON_VERSION: 1.0-beta-2

           [java] [INFO] ------------------------------------------------------------------------

           [java] [INFO] Building JBossAS Component Matrix

           [java] [INFO]    task-segment: [install]

           [java] [INFO] ------------------------------------------------------------------------

           [java] [INFO] [enforcer:enforce {execution: ban-bad-dependencies}]

           [java] [INFO] [site:attach-descriptor]

           [java] [INFO] Preparing source:jar

           [java] [WARNING] Removing: jar from forked lifecycle, to prevent recursive invocation.

           [java] [INFO] [enforcer:enforce {execution: ban-bad-dependencies}]

           [java] [INFO] [source:jar {execution: attach-sources}]

           [java] [INFO] [install:install]

           [java] [INFO] Installing /data/jboss_builds/src/svn/JBoss_5_1_0_GA/component-matrix/pom.xml to /home/jboss_build/.m2/repository/org/jboss/jbossas/jboss-as-component-matrix/5.1.0.GA/jboss-as-component-matrix-5.1.0.GA.pom

           [java] [INFO] ------------------------------------------------------------------------

           [java] [INFO] Building JBoss Application Server Parent POM

           [java] [INFO]    task-segment: [install]

           [java] [INFO] ------------------------------------------------------------------------

           [java] [INFO] [enforcer:enforce {execution: ban-bad-dependencies}]

           [java] [INFO] [enforcer:enforce {execution: enforce-java-maven-versions}]

           [java] [INFO] [enforcer:enforce {execution: enforce-plugin-versions}]

           [java] [INFO] [site:attach-descriptor]

           [java] [INFO] Preparing source:jar

           [java] [WARNING] Removing: jar from forked lifecycle, to prevent recursive invocation.

           [java] [INFO] [enforcer:enforce {execution: ban-bad-dependencies}]

           [java] [INFO] [enforcer:enforce {execution: enforce-java-maven-versions}]

           [java] [INFO] [enforcer:enforce {execution: enforce-plugin-versions}]

           [java] [INFO] [source:jar {execution: attach-sources}]

           [java] [INFO] [install:install]

           [java] [INFO] Installing /data/jboss_builds/src/svn/JBoss_5_1_0_GA/pom.xml to /home/jboss_build/.m2/repository/org/jboss/jbossas/jboss-as-parent/5.1.0.GA/jboss-as-parent-5.1.0.GA.pom

           [java] [INFO] ------------------------------------------------------------------------

           [java] [INFO] Building JBoss Application Server Thirdparty Build

           [java] [INFO]    task-segment: [install]

           [java] [INFO] ------------------------------------------------------------------------

           [java] Downloading: http://repository.jboss.org/maven2/org/jboss/maven/plugins/maven-jboss-license-plugin/1.0.0/maven-jboss-license-plugin-1.0.0.pom

           [java] Downloading: http://repo1.maven.org/maven2/org/jboss/maven/plugins/maven-jboss-license-plugin/1.0.0/maven-jboss-license-plugin-1.0.0.pom

           [java] Downloading: http://repository.jboss.org/maven2/org/jboss/maven/plugins/maven-jboss-license-plugin/1.0.0/maven-jboss-license-plugin-1.0.0.pom

           [java] Downloading: http://repo1.maven.org/maven2/org/jboss/maven/plugins/maven-jboss-license-plugin/1.0.0/maven-jboss-license-plugin-1.0.0.pom

           [java] [INFO] ------------------------------------------------------------------------

           [java] [ERROR] BUILD ERROR

           [java] [INFO] ------------------------------------------------------------------------

           [java] [INFO] Error building POM (may not be this project's POM).

           [java]

           [java]

           [java] Project ID: org.jboss.maven.plugins:maven-jboss-license-plugin

           [java]

           [java] Reason: POM 'org.jboss.maven.plugins:maven-jboss-license-plugin' not found in repository: Unable to download the artifact from any repository

           [java]

           [java]   org.jboss.maven.plugins:maven-jboss-license-plugin:pom:1.0.0

           [java]

           [java] from the specified remote repositories:

           [java]   snapshots.jboss.org (http://snapshots.jboss.org/maven2),

           [java]   central (http://repo1.maven.org/maven2),

           [java]   repository.jboss.org (http://repository.jboss.org/maven2)

           [java]  for project org.jboss.maven.plugins:maven-jboss-license-plugin

           [java]

           [java]

           [java] [INFO] ------------------------------------------------------------------------

           [java] [INFO] For more information, run Maven with the -e switch

           [java] [INFO] ------------------------------------------------------------------------

           [java] [INFO] Total time: 10 seconds

           [java] [INFO] Finished at: Tue Mar 26 12:51:50 CET 2013

           [java] [INFO] Final Memory: 15M/37M

           [java] [INFO] ------------------------------------------------------------------------

           [java] Java Result: 1

       

      BUILD FAILED

      /data/jboss_builds/src/svn/JBoss_5_1_0_GA/build/build.xml:1084: Unable to build maven modules.  See maven output for details.

       

      Total time: 12 seconds

      I tried manually above failing downloads:

       

      $ wget http://repository.jboss.org/maven2/org/jboss/maven/plugins/maven-jboss-license-plugin/1.0.0/maven-jboss-license-plugin-1.0.0.pom

      ...

      2013-03-26 12:25:12 ERROR 403: Forbidden.

       

      $ wget http://repo1.maven.org/maven2/org/jboss/maven/plugins/maven-jboss-license-plugin/1.0.0/maven-jboss-license-plugin-1.0.0.pom

      ...

      2013-03-26 12:25:21 ERROR 404: Not Found.

       

      $ wget http://repository.jboss.org/maven2/org/jboss/maven/plugins/maven-jboss-license-plugin/1.0.0/maven-jboss-license-plugin-1.0.0.pom

      ...

      2013-03-26 12:25:39 ERROR 403: Forbidden.

       

      $ wget http://repo1.maven.org/maven2/org/jboss/maven/plugins/maven-jboss-license-plugin/1.0.0/maven-jboss-license-plugin-1.0.0.pom

      ...

      2013-03-26 12:25:58 ERROR 404: Not Found.

      How can I fix that?

       

      Update:

       

      Found out some active repo (https://maven-us.nuxeo.org/nexus/content/repositories/public/org/jboss/maven/plugins/maven-buildmagic-thirdparty-plugin)

      But still looking where it has to be set up..

       

      Update again :

      Dug dug dug and found out that adding this in settings.xml seems to work...

       

      <mirror>
        <id></id>
        <mirrorOf>repository.jboss.org</mirrorOf>
        <name>nuxeo Mirror.</name>
        <url>https://maven-us.nuxeo.org/nexus/content/repositories/public</url>
      </mirror>

       

      Looks like it was a maven newby question...

      Hope this could help anyone...